Details of the offer

Your Role:As Country Director, you will play a pivotal role in shaping the direction and impact of CARE's work in Kenya as we focus on hiring the full time CD. Your responsibilities will include:Strategic Leadership: Designing and implementing organizational change processes to align with the CARE 2030 vision and global objectives. Developing and executing the CARE Kenya's country office (CO) strategy, ensuring alignment with regional and country contexts, and CARE's global mission and impact drivers: gender equality, locally led, and globally scaled.Talent Management: Leading talent management and succession planning initiatives to build a skilled, diverse, and high-performing team. Providing mentorship and support to staff, fostering a culture of growth, learning, and excellence.Compliance and Risk Management: Ensuring compliance with legal requirements, safety protocols, and risk management practices. Advocating for and upholding CARE's safeguarding policy throughout the organization and all programming.Advocacy and Partnership: Building and maintaining productive relationships with stakeholders, donors, and partners to maximize CARE's impact and influence.Program Impact and Scale: Ensuring that programs are designed and implemented based on sound analysis, address underlying causes of poverty, and align with CARE's Program Strategy and standards for quality.Resource Mobilization: Mobilizing resources and securing funding to support ongoing and future program activities. Developing and implementing an effective resource mobilization strategy, in line with the CO program strategy, to ensure financial viability and promote growth.QualificationsEducation: A bachelor's degree in a related field. Master's degree preferred.Experience: Minimum of 10 years of experience in international development, humanitarian, and nexus spaces, preferably in complex operating environments. 6-8 years in senior management within the development field, demonstrating leadership in delivering high-quality programs, influencing strategies, and development initiatives in Kenya.Leadership and Advocacy : Proven track record of strategic leadership and operational management, influencing at national and international levels, with a commitment to a rights-based approach, especially in advocating for women's rights. Passion for gender equality, diversity, and social justice, with a track record of securing funding from major donors and multilateral organizations.Change Management & Relationship Building: Strong interpersonal skills, with the ability to lead diverse teams in cross-cultural settings. Experience in managing complex change processes and fostering relationships across diverse internal and external stakeholders in multicultural settings.Team Leadership: Skilled in leading and motivating diverse teams in remote locations, fostering excellent team performance aligned with CARE's core values and policies.Representation: Demonstrated success in representing an organization with partners, government agencies, private sectors, media, and donors at senior levels both nationally and globally.Financial Management and Fiscal Responsibility: Demonstrated experience in responsible program design, financial management, audits and donor compliance and reporting. Understand the basics of financial oversight.
